Long Cluster Tomato Seeds

Characteristics and Uses of Long Cluster Tomato

The Long Cluster Tomato (Solanum lycopersicum) is a unique variety known for its long, clustered bunches of tomatoes that offer a delicious, sweet flavor. These tomatoes are perfect for fresh salads, sauces, and can be grown in both gardens and containers. Their robust growth and easy care make them a favorite among gardeners.

Growing Conditions for Long Cluster Tomato

  • Light Requirements: Full sun
  • Soil Type: Well-draining, rich in organic matter
  • Temperature Range: 70–85°F

Planting Tips for Long Cluster Tomato

  • Start seeds indoors 6–8 weeks before the last frost
  • Transplant seedlings outdoors after the danger of frost has passed
  • Space plants 18–24 inches apart for optimal growth

Watering Instructions and Tips

  • Water deeply and consistently, especially during dry spells
  • Avoid watering the leaves to prevent fungal diseases

Growing Zones

  • USDA Zones: 5–9
  • Global Zones: Suitable for temperate climates

FAQ

How often should I water Long Cluster Tomatoes?

Water consistently, ensuring the soil is moist but not waterlogged, especially during the fruiting phase.

Can I grow Long Cluster Tomatoes in containers?

Yes, Long Cluster Tomatoes are perfect for container gardening and will thrive in large pots with well-draining soil.
